Story
Enid is about four years old and, without reading ahead, go ahead and guess what specific breeds she is. There are five! Drumroll, please... Enid is bull mastiff, Neapolitan mastiff, German shepherd, cane corso, and labrador retriever! All of those in 70 pounds of cuteness. Enid loves laying in the grass, playing fetch (but not so much bringing the item back to you), chewing on sticks, sleeping on her back, getting belly rubs, riding in cars, and hanging out with her people. She is also a fan of playing in water from the hose or in a kiddie pool. However, don't ask Enid to step outside to potty in the rain unless you're willing to go out with her! She is super smart and already knows sit, shake, down, place, kennel, come, look at me, through the legs, and wait (for food). Squeaky toys will motivate her; toys, not as much. Go figure! Because Enid is such a smarty pants, keeping her mind busy helps to keep her out of mischief. While she can't do crossword puzzles, she is really good at snuffle mats, lick mats, and peanut butter stuffed Kongs! If you're looking for a super snuggly, Velcro pooch, Enid is not that. She's fairly independent but will seek out pets and attention. She also likes to sleep in her human's bed sometimes, if she's not napping in her own dog bed. Story
Archer, our friend from City of Raytown Animal Services, got his first pup cup a few days ago. He wasn't sure what this small cup of goodness was and whether it was really for him??? It wasn't long before he politely dove right in. Afterward, he enjoyed a nice Sunday walk in one of our local parks. He was polite, didn't pull hard on his leash, and was happy to meet new friends on his day out. Archer is an amazing tan neutered male mastiff. He's around 5 years old and 85 pounds. Archer's in the sweet spot of dogs -- not a puppy but he's for sure not an old man. He's old enough to know better and young enough to have many adventures! He is not a fan of cats or high-energy dogs. He wants to Netflix and chill and take a walk on a nice day. He doesn't have a lot of demands, aside from a loving home.
